COVID-19 testing numbers for the five-county jurisdiction, as of May 5

WUPHD 05/05/

Baraga — 79 referred for testing, four tests canceled, one positive, no non-Michigan cases, 64 negatives, 10 tests pending, no deaths.

Gogebic — 157 referred for testing, four tests canceled, four positives, one non-Michigan case, 128 negatives, 20 tests pending, one death.

Houghton — 389 referred for testing, 15 tests canceled, two positives, no non-Michigan cases, 331 negatives, 41 tests pending, no deaths.

Keweenaw — 33 referred for testing, three tests canceled, no positives, no non-Michigan cases, 28 negatives, two tests pending, no deaths.

Ontonagon — 41 referred for testing, two tests canceled, no positives, no non-Michigan cases, 33 negatives, six tests pending, no deaths.

Total — 699 referred for testing, 28 tests canceled, seven positives, one non-Michigan case, 584 negatives, 79 tests pending, one death.

Canceled tests are those tests that a healthcare provider decided not to submit after other diagnostic procedures confirmed a different illness, a clinical decision was made not to test after a referral was already assigned, or a patient declined testing after a referral had been assigned. Most canceled tests were done early on in the process but may continue as guidance and processes change.

Deaths are also included in the number of positive tests. They are not additional positives.
